From 46f6d309fd4f2f8ab4acddc2dfe16e1245bf82a4 Mon Sep 17 00:00:00 2001
From: Joseph Mirabel <jmirabel@laas.fr>
Date: Mon, 6 Apr 2020 11:24:54 +0200
Subject: [PATCH] Make odom child frame parameterizable.

---
 src/sot_loader.cpp | 5 +++++
 1 file changed, 5 insertions(+)

diff --git a/src/sot_loader.cpp b/src/sot_loader.cpp
index 9318ba7..2bf7ac4 100644
--- a/src/sot_loader.cpp
+++ b/src/sot_loader.cpp
@@ -118,6 +118,11 @@ SotLoader::SotLoader()
 
   freeFlyerPose_.header.frame_id = "odom";
   freeFlyerPose_.child_frame_id = "base_link";
+  if (ros::param::get("/sot/tf_base_link",
+                      freeFlyerPose_.child_frame_id)) {
+    ROS_INFO_STREAM("Publishing " << freeFlyerPose_.child_frame_id << " wrt "
+                                  << freeFlyerPose_.header.frame_id);
+  }
 }
 
 SotLoader::~SotLoader() {
-- 
GitLab